What affects the price

Replacing your windows with impact-rated glass involves a few variables that shift your final total. First, the size and number of openings in your home play the biggest role, as custom measurements require more material and labor. The style of window you choose—like single-hung, casement, or sliders—also changes the math, as does the frame material, such as vinyl versus aluminum. If you live in an area with stricter wind-load requirements, that might necessitate thicker glass or specialized hardware.

What is an impact window?

Impact windows are designed to withstand severe weather, like the storms we sometimes see hitting the coast near Boston. They feature laminated glass that stays in place even when broken, preventing dangerous debris from entering your home. This offers superior protection compared to standard windows.

What are the drawbacks of impact windows?

While impact windows offer great protection, some homeowners note a slight tint or distortion in the glass, though modern options have minimized this. They can also be a higher initial investment than standard windows. However, the long-term benefits in storm-prone areas like Boston often outweigh these considerations.
